40代からのフリーランスエンジニア向け・案件検索サイト【SEES】
フリーランスのLaravel案件はWebエンジニアの求人で一般的になりつつあることをご存じでしょうか。この記事では、Laravelの基礎知識や案件を獲得する方法、Laravelの展望などを紹介しています。Laravelに興味がある方は、最後まで読んみて下さい。
<業界実績18年>
ミドル・シニアフリーランス専門
エージェントSEES
40~60代以上のシニアエンジニア案件探しは、私たちにお任せください!
ご登録者様限定で、Webに公開していない非公開案件をご提案いたします。
目次
「Laravelのフリーランス案件って稼げるの?」
「どうやったら高単価のLaravel案件を獲得できるのか知りたい」
このように、WebエンジニアでLaravelに興味を持っている方には沢山の疑問や不安があるのではないでしょうか。
本記事では、Laravelが持つ特徴やLaravel案件の動向に加え、Laravel案件の単価相場や稼ぐために必要な能力、Laravel案件の将来性などを紹介しています。
この記事を読むことで、Laravel案件を獲得するための知識や収入がアップする方法を把握できます。その情報をもとにLaravelを扱うかの判断基準になるため、自身のエンジニアとしての道筋が明確になるでしょう。
フリーランスエンジニアとして活躍されている方は、是非、最後まで読んでみて下さい。
Laravel(ララベル)とは、ブログなどの動的なWebページを作成するPHPのフレームワークの1つで、同じフレームワークであるSymphony(シンフォニー)を基に開発されたPHPフレームワークです。
はじめに、使いやすいと評判であるLaravelの特徴を紹介します。
Laravelは、「MVC」と呼ばれる開発方法を採用しているため、まだ開発に慣れていない初心者でも理解しやすい仕様となっています。
MVCとは「Model」「View」「Controller」の頭文字から取った略称で、それぞれ独立した機能に分けて開発を行います。
MVCを採用することで、システムやアプリ開発を分業できるメリットがあり、1人あたりのエンジニアへの負担が少なくなります。
Laravelには、開発環境を容易に構築するための関連ソフトが豊富に用意されています。
PHPやWebサーバーをローカルマシンにインストールしなくても、最適な開発環境が手に入る「Laravel Homestead」や、仮想マシンを簡単に管理できる「Vagrant」などがあります。
また、ライブラリ管理ツールとして「Composer」があり、エンジニアの強い味方となるソフトウェアが充実しています。
Larevelは、ディレクトリ構成に高度な拡張性を備えているため、自由度の高いディレクトリ構造が可能になるでしょう。
ほかのフレームワークよりも規約が少ないことから、さまざまなMVCのパターンやレイヤードアーキテクチャ、ADRなどのアーキテクチャを採用することができます。
ディレクトリの管理が難しいという面もありますが、自由度や利便性、拡張性の高さがデメリットを上回っていると言えます。
Laravelは、Artisan(アルティザン)と呼ばれるコマンドツールを初めから実装しているため、分かりやすいコードでさまざまな設定やアプリケーションを作ることができます。
Artisanコマンドは、フレームワークに沿ったマイグレーションファイルやモデルファイルの作成などに便利なCLIコマンドです。
Laravelの特徴として、煩雑な操作も簡単にできることが魅力でしょう。
複雑なファイルアップロード処理を簡単に実装できることもLaravelの特徴の1つです。
Laravelには、公式が用意しているファイルストレージ用のインターフェースがあります。そのため難解な操作は必要なく、数行のコードを入力するだけでアップロードの処理が可能になります。
またパラメーターとプラグインによる保存先の指定ができ、昨今では一般的になっているクラウドストレージへの保存が行えます。
Laravelは、PHP言語でシステムを構築する際に多く使われています。
具体的な開発例を挙げていくと、WebメディアやECサイト、口コミサイトや予約サイトなどがあり、SNSといったトレンドを生み出す身近なアプリケーションもLaravelで作られています。
ここでは、Laravel案件の動向と特徴を紹介していきます。
Laravel案件には自社開発の案件が多くあり、受託案件よりも作業の自由度が高い傾向にあります。
自社開発案件では、工程を自分たちで組み立てたりアイデアを提案したりできることから、柔軟な業務が可能です。また納得のいかない部分に時間をかけることができるため、企業の強みをアピールできるでしょう。
Laravelは、ワークライフバランスを重視するベンチャー企業などで積極的に採用されています。
大型受託案件の場合は、クライアントの要望に沿った開発を行い納期を厳守する必要があるため、ワークライフバランスが崩れやすい現状です。
その要因の1つとして、仕事を自宅に持ち帰れないという点があります。企業によっては、安全保障の観点から現場のみで業務に取り組む規約を設けている場合があります。
一方、新しい技術に触れる機会が多いため、向上心がある方にはチャンスとも言えるでしょう。
案件によってワークライフバランスが左右されるLaravel案件ですが、フリーランスを対象にしている場合は在宅可能な案件も存在します。
あるフリーランスエージェントでは、Laravel案件全体の半数以上がリモート可能であり、多様な働き方にマッチした求人が増えてきています。
さまざまな求人媒体を利用することで自身の希望に沿った勤務形態が見つかるでしょう。
Laravelは、システム開発に関する案件が豊富にあります。
上記で触れたWebメディアや予約サイトのほかにも、マッチングサービス新規開発やゲーム関連の開発案件などが多くあります。案件の傾向として、BtoBよりもBtoCに向けたものが見受けられます。
PHP開発案件で見るとLaravelはCakePHPの次に多いとされ、その需要はさらに高まっていくでしょう。
▼Laravelの案件を検索する
シニアエンジニア向け案件検索サイト - SEESLaravel案件をフリーランスとして請け負う場合の単価相場は以下の通りです。
平均的な月額単価は約72万円となっており、その振れ幅は約40~125万円となっています。フリーランスの場合では、低い金額の案件は競争率が高い傾向にあるため、平均月額単価に近い案件を狙うと獲得しやすいでしょう。
なお高度なスキルや経験を持ち合わせていなければ、単価が下がることも留意しておきましょう。
次に、経験年数によるLaravel案件の単価相場を見ていきましょう。
週5日常駐し、月に140~180時間働く場合と仮定します。経験年数が1年未満では35万円前後となり、経験1~2年では42万円前後となります。経験2~3年になると60万円を超え、経験3~5年では約70万円になり、経験5年以上では84万円前後となります。
Laravelでは、実務経験と収入が比例して増えることがわかるでしょう。
一般的にエンジニアの平均年収は実務経験により高くなる傾向ですが、Lavarel案件もスキルを磨くことで高い年収を得ることができます。
それはエンジニアスキルに限らず、業務を遂行する上で求められる能力も兼ね備えることで実現できるでしょう。
ここでは、Laravel案件で稼ぐために必要や能力を紹介します。
最新バージョンのLaravelを扱えるようにすることで、高額単価案件を獲得しやすくなります。
Laravelはリリースから幾度もバージョンアップをしており、1つ前のバージョンと比べると多くの変更点が出てきます。そのため、常に最新のバージョンを把握しておかなければ案件を受注できない可能性があるでしょう。
Laravelの更新スピードにアンテナを張っておくことが肝要です。
Laravelにおいて、高額な大型案件になるとチームを導くマネジメントスキルが求められます。
個人で開発できる案件とは違い、大手企業が主体で行うWebアプリケーションの開発では大人数で取り組むケースが大半です。自身がチームリーダーとして臨む場合、効率的な作業工程を組んで納期までに完了するスキルが必要になってきます。
いかに集団をまとめるか、というマネジメントスキルを身につけるといいでしょう。
Laravelは、Webアプリケーション開発を主体に行うため、データベースに関する知識が欠かせません。
数あるデータベースの中でもMySQLを扱うケースが多く、理解の度合いで単価に影響が出てくることもあるでしょう。また実際に扱った経験が重要視されるため、理解とともに十分な実務経歴が必要です。
Laravelだけでなく、データベース周りの知識も把握しておきましょう。
Laravel案件では、アプリケーションの開発だけでなくユーザーとデータのやりとりを行うフロンエンドを担当するケースがあります。
必要とされるフロントエンド技術として、ユーザーインターフェース構築に用いるJavaScriptをはじめとして多様なフレームワークがあります。また、案件によってはデザイン関連の知識も求められこともあります。
動向が激しいフロントエンド技術にも目を光らせておくといいでしょう。
昨今では、AWS(Amazon Web Services)と呼ばれるクラウドサーバー上で構築する案件が増えてきています。
AWSは、これまでのサーバーとは違い、クラウド環境に仮想サーバーを構築するサービスを指します。利便性の良さに加え、実績を出しやすいことから、近い将来にはクラウド化の需要が高まるとされています。
現状ではAWSの知識を持つエンジニアは人材難であるため、AWSの知識の取得はメリットとなり得るでしょう。
高額単価のLaravel案件を獲得するには、マネジメントをはじめとするビジネススキルの習得が欠かせません。
Webアプリケーション開発のスキルはもちろん、情報収集や分析・資料作成などの実務スキルに加えて、戦略策定や問題解決といった企業本体に貢献できるスキルも重宝されやすいでしょう。
複数のビジネススキルは、仕事の幅と年収アップに繋がる要素の1つと言えます。
多くのLaravel案件に参画するならば、GitHubを扱えるようにするといいでしょう。
GitHubは業務の効率化を図る目的で作られ、複数のエンジニアがソースコードを共有できるツールです。
Lavarel案件では、GitHubを用いた実務経験が求められる場合もあるため、GitHubの把握は仕事の獲得に貢献します。
Laravel以外のフレームワークを習得することで、案件獲得の増加に繋がります。
Laravelの求人案件では、ほかのPHPフレームワークと組み合わさっているケースがあります。CakePHPやSymfony、Zend Frameworkなどとの組み合わせがあるため、Laravelの使い方を学んだ後に、ほかのフレームワークの習得を目指してみるといいでしょう。
▼関連記事
おすすめのPHPフレームワーク11選|メリットやデメリットについても解説
Laravelを含むエンジニアは、それまでの開発経験で評価が分かれます。
一般的に、開発経験が3年を超えるキャリアがあると高単価案件が獲得しやすいとされています。さらに、個人ではなくチームでの実務経験は高く評価される傾向があり、大型受託案件にも参画しやすくなるでしょう。
経験年数が浅い場合には、単価を問わずチームでの実務経験を積み上げることが重要です。
高単価のLaravel案件の求人には、上流工程経験者が記載されているケースがあります。
上流工程とは、主にシステム概要や機能を決定する工程を指します。クライアントとの円滑なコミュケーション能力や情報収集能力、マネジメント能力など、求められるスキルは多岐に渡るでしょう。
何よりも上流工程の経験者は、システム開発の初期段階を把握しているため、企業から即戦力と判断されやすく案件獲得の大きな武器となります。
Laravelのフリーランス案件を獲得する方法として、フリーランスエージェントを活用することが代表的です。
ITエンジニア案件を安定して提案しているエージェントサービスは、Laravel案件を含め希望に沿った案件を随時提供してくれます。高額案件やサポートの有無、リモートワークが可能であるかなど、自身の条件に合う案件を獲得しやすいでしょう。
フリーランスでなくても気軽に相談できる点も魅力と言えます。
Laravel未経験者であれば、技術や知識を身につけることが前提となります。
身につける順序として、初心者向けの書籍や学習サイトで開発環境の構築を学び、フォーム入力画面やログイン画面といった基礎的な機能の作成を経て、応用的な機能の実装へと進みます。
一通りのプログラムが作成できるようになった後、クラウドソーシングなどで実績を積み上げていくことで、エージェントによる案件獲得が可能になります。
▼Laravelの案件を検索する
シニアエンジニア向け案件検索サイト - SEESLaravel案件は、将来的に安定して供給される見込みが高くなります。
LaravelはPHPフレームワークにおいて高い評価を得ており、案件需要も継続して存在しています。Laravelが持つ利便性や機能性の良さが、現在の開発環境とマッチしている結果と言えるでしょう。
しかし、Laravel以上のフレームワークが台頭することもあるため、開発環境のトレンドに注視
しておくことが肝要です。
Laravelは、ほかのPHPフレームワークと比べて新しい技術とされています。
後発でリリースされた分、ワークライフバランスを重視した企業に好んで採用されており、自身の人生設計にも良い影響を与えてくれます。
開発エンジニア経験者であればLaravelを習得するハードルは高くないため、Laravelスキルの習得を検討してみましょう。
40代~60代向けミドル・シニアフリーランスエンジニアの案件サイト『SEES』
40代~60代でエンジニアとして活躍したいと考えている方におすすめなのが、株式会社Miraieが運営する、ミドル・シニアエンジニア向けの案件サイト『SEES』(https://miraie-group.jp/sees/)です。
SEESとは-Senior Engineer Entrustment Service-の略称で、40代~60代エンジニア向けの案件紹介サービス。
エンジニア業界は、40代以上の転職はなかなか厳しい市場だと言われています。
転職ではなくフリーランスとして案件を獲得することを視野にいれてみてもいいかもしれません。
SEESの場合、掲載している案件は主に年齢不問ですので、年齢制限に関係なく、純粋にスキルや希望条件での案件を探すことが可能です。
会社員よりも個人事業主としてプロジェクトを請け負う形であれば、働き方としても選べる立場にありますよね。
給与の支払いサイトは30日で統一されています。
また、取引社数が5,000社以上と多く、新しい案件が集まりやすくなっています。
さらに、SEESに登録をすると最新・未公開案件を獲得することができます。
独立してフリーランスになっても仕事が途切れる心配はありません!
『SEES』(https://miraie-group.jp/sees)を利用して新しい働き方を手に入れてみては…!?
皆さまから選ばれてミドル・シニアエンジニア向け検索サイト三冠達成しております!
株式会社Miraieが運営する『SEES(https://miraie-group.jp/sees)』は、 「シニアエンジニア向け検索10サイトを対象にしたサイト比較イメージ調査」のなかで、
上記3項目においてNo.1を獲得ししております。
株式会社Miraie
2007年設立のシステム開発会社。首都圏を中心にWeb・IT関連事業、コンサルティングサービス、人材派遣サービスなどを展開。 SES事業や受託開発などを中心にノウハウを蓄積しながら、関連事業へとビジネスの裾野を広げています。
監修者インフォメーション